  • This study examines the result of infrastructure vertical separation in Mongolian railway. Mongolian railway started railway reform it include a lot of steps with the aim of increase railway capacity and performance. One main step is to implement infrastructure vertical separation and to find out optimal Infrastructure charging price. We used secondary data from Ulaabaatar Railway and Authority of Mongolian railway from 2005 to 2011. In order to see the infrastructure vertical separation result we have chosen possible infrastructure charging price then forecasted necessarily variable until 2014 after that formulated LP model.
    The results of this study suggest that, infrastructure vertical separation can increase the Mongolian railway capacity with less government cost compared with direct investment to UBR. Beginning of study we considered suitable infrastructure charging price important for private investment. The results also suggest that obligation level from government is another technique to promote private company investment in Mongolian case.
